Elephant Rock
AI-suggested draft · review before you go
Elephant Rock is a 2.6-mile trail within the Silver Valley Trailhead system in California that offers mountain bikers a scenic ride through the region. Named for its distinctive geological features, this trail provides an accessible option for riders exploring the Silver Valley area. The moderate length makes it ideal for those looking to log some quality trail time without committing to a full day of riding.
